Do have Solution for two different untrusted network domain?

In a scenario that I have two network domain which do not trust each other. The Microsoft share folder cannot provide stable shared folder service because two domains do not trust each other. Can NAS provide stable solution or not?

    What you want is not a supported configuration.

    However if you are willing to build trust between the two domains there is an option to "include trusted domains".

    You could try joining domain 1 with the NAS, having configured domain 1 to have one-way trust of domain 2. That might be enough. Not sure on that though. It's possible the trust might need to work both ways.
  • Thanks for your reply.
    But what if we are not able to build any trust(neither one-way or two-way) between two domains? Can NAS join one domain and provide stable share folder service to both domain?
  • It is not quite the same, however it is possible for the NAS to work in WORKGROUP mode, where it is not joined to either domain, but has user/groups created on the nas itself with each share can have it's own set of users/group/permissions.

    This way users on either domain can access the nas/shares based on the nas-specific users/groups/shares.
